Sir Ed Davey, the leader of the Liberal Democrats, says there is no word in the English language for a parent who has lost a child.
"Many had to bury their children alone, many couldn't be there at the end, meanwhile No 10 partied," he says. "Does the Prime Minister understand - does he care - about the enormous hurt his actions have caused to bereaved families across our country?
"Will he finally accept that the only decent thing he can do now is resign?"
Mr Johnson maintains he does "care deeply" about the hurt following "the suggestion" Covid rules were broken.
"I've apologised several times, but I must say we must wait for the outcome of the inquiry... in the meantime, we must focus on the issues that matter to the British people."
